Adrian stopped in his tracks. He had wanted to ask how Wendy had suddenly revealed the truth to Gianna.

But seeing Gianna so deeply shaken, and hearing Pepper explain that she had to compete soon, he sighed and decided not to press further.

Instead, he patted Gianna's shoulder and comforted her. "Gianna, no matter what, you are still the heiress of the Malone family. Focus on the competition."

Gianna's pupils trembled, and the tears she had been holding back rolled down instantly. She quickly lowered her head to wipe them away. When she looked up again, she was sniffling, smiling with a mix of emotion and joy.

"Dad, do you still want me as your daughter?" Her eyes were full of hope.

Adrian nodded and patted her shoulder again. Only then did Gianna break fully into a smile, wiping away the last of her tears. "Dad, I'll do my best in the competition. I'll make you and the Malone family proud! Can I go get ready now?"

"Go ahead. I believe in you." Seeing her both crying and laughing, with the slap mark on her face still faintly visible, Adrian pitied her.

Gianna stepped forward and hugged him. "Thank you, Dad."

She said it quickly, then turned and walked into the corridor.

Pepper brushed at the corner of her eye, watching Gianna's figure disappear, then looked at Adrian with a faint, grateful smile.

"Adrian, you told the media that you're Gianna's family member. Could you come with me and cheer for Gianna from the stands?"

Adrian frowned slightly, but Pepper continued, "I've something to tell you about my sister, and about Gianna and my sister revealing their relationship…"

Hearing that it involved Wendy, and wanting to understand why Wendy insisted Gianna was now her niece instead, he paused before nodding.

"Let's go."

Inside the stadium, Anneliese stood at the individual competition station assigned to her, with less than five minutes remaining before the start.

She quickly checked all the equipment at station 45, making sure everything was functioning properly. Only then did she take a deep breath.

A ripple of praise went through the crowd. Most of the competitors shown so far had been boys, and though a few girls had appeared, none had stood out like this.

Gianna seemed to radiate her own aura, and she appeared younger than her years. She clearly enjoyed this moment in the spotlight, smiling gracefully at the host with effortless poise.

At that moment, the camera shifted to Anneliese. The host seemed slightly taken aback for a moment before exaggerating. "Contestant #45, are you sure you didn't wander here from some celebrity reality show?" he asked teasingly.

The camera, almost as if favoring her, gave Anneliese a close-up shot, holding her flawless face on screen.

Unlike Gianna's meticulously sculpted beauty, Anneliese's long hair was casually tied, her makeup minimal, her features crisp and clear. She stood quietly, like a mountain stream formed from freshly melted snow.

At first glance, her presence seemed to exist on a different plane than the other contestants. Yet, the calmness she exuded felt so natural that, upon a second look, it blended perfectly with the scene around her.

After a brief moment of silence, the crowd's reaction grew even louder. Gianna clenched her fists while lowering her gaze, her eyes full of jealousy. How dare Anneliese steal her spotlight!
